Aims

We aim to determine if faba beans in the high rainfall zone respond to high rates of phosphorus, in-crop nitrogen and/or a complete/intensive nutritional and disease management package.

Key messages
  • PBA Amberley faba bean produced yields over 5 t/ha.
  • Faba bean did not respond to Phosphorus or Nitrogen inputs.
  • Additional fungicide and nutrition treatments increased yield by 400 kg/ha – however treatments tested were not economically viable.

Herbicide

Pre-seeding: 700g/ha terbuthylazine (875g/kg) + 700g/ha simazine (900g/kg) + 700g/ha diuron (900g/kg)

At seeding: 1.1kg/ha carbetamide (900g/kg) + 180g/ha flumioxazin (500g/kg) +2.5L/ha glyphosate (570g/L)

25 May: 80mL/ha Ecopar (pyraflufen-ethyl 20 g/L) + 0.2% BS1000

18 June: 330mL/ha clethodim (360g/L) + 100g/ha butroxydim (250g/kg) + 1% MSO +100mL/ha haloxyfop (520g/L)
27 Nov: 2L/ha diquat (200g/L) + 0.2% BS1000

Insecticide

At seeding: 80mL/ha bifenthrin (250g/L)

14 Sep: 100mL/ha sulfoxaflor (500g/kg) + 80mL/ha alpha cypermethrin (100g/L)

Inoculant Inoculated using TagTeam and Alosca Group EF rhizobia packed with the seed.
